Thiruvananthapuram: High level police meeting, headed by Chief Minister Pinarayi Vijayan has begun in Thiruvananthapuram. Nedumkandam custodial death and some present time incidents of police torture has tarnished the image of the state Government and hence the meeting. The meeting will discuss about the third degree tortures and ‘uruttikkola’, the barbarous method of rolling over heavy rods on the accused on custody.
DySPs and other high level officials are taking part in the meeting. Additional SPs, State House Officers and officials from all districts will also join the meeting via video conferencing.
